Optimizing Athletic Performance and Comfort

Strategic apparel choices significantly impact athletic performance and overall comfort during physical activity. Consider these essential tips when selecting and utilizing activewear.

Tip 1: Prioritize Moisture-Wicking Fabrics

Moisture-wicking fabrics draw perspiration away from the skin, maintaining comfort and preventing chafing during exercise. This feature is crucial for garments worn in direct contact with the skin, such as base layers or tanks.

Tip 2: Ensure Adequate Ventilation

Proper ventilation regulates body temperature and prevents overheating. Look for garments with breathable fabrics or strategically placed ventilation panels, particularly for high-intensity activities or warm climates.

Tip 3: Select the Appropriate Fit

Garments should allow for a full range of motion without restriction. Consider the intended activity when selecting the fit a looser fit may be preferable for yoga, while a more compressive fit may be suitable for running or weightlifting.

Tip 4: Layer Strategically

Layering allows for adaptability to changing weather conditions or activity levels. Start with a moisture-wicking base layer and add or remove layers as needed to maintain optimal comfort.

Tip 5: Consider Fabric Durability and Care

Activewear should withstand frequent washing and maintain its performance characteristics over time. Look for durable fabrics and follow care instructions to maximize garment lifespan.

Tip 6: Match Apparel to the Activity

Different activities have different apparel requirements. Yoga may necessitate flexible, form-fitting attire, while running might require lightweight, breathable fabrics. Consider the specific demands of the activity when selecting appropriate apparel.

Tip 7: Prioritize Comfort and Functionality

Ultimately, athletic apparel should enhance both comfort and performance. Prioritize functional features over aesthetics when making purchasing decisions, ensuring that garments effectively support the intended activity.
